我们提供一站式网上办事大厅招投标所需全套资料,包括师生办事大厅介绍PPT、一网通办平台产品解决方案、
师生服务大厅产品技术参数,以及对应的标书参考文件,详请联系客服。
随着信息技术的不断发展,教育行业的信息化建设已成为提升管理效率和服务质量的重要手段。其中,“一站式网上办事大厅”作为现代教育信息化的重要组成部分,为职业院校提供了高效、便捷的数字化服务支持。本文将从技术角度出发,结合具体源码实现,深入探讨“一站式网上办事大厅”在职业院校中的设计与开发过程。
一、引言
近年来,国家大力推进教育信息化发展,强调“互联网+教育”的深度融合。职业院校作为培养技能型人才的重要基地,亟需通过信息化手段提升管理效率和教学服务水平。在此背景下,“一站式网上办事大厅”应运而生,成为连接学校、教师、学生与家长的重要平台。该系统不仅简化了传统线下流程,还提升了数据处理的自动化水平,为职业院校的数字化转型提供了有力支撑。
二、系统概述与技术选型
“一站式网上办事大厅”是一个集信息查询、业务办理、通知公告、数据统计等功能于一体的综合服务平台。在技术实现上,通常采用前后端分离的架构,前端使用主流的JavaScript框架如Vue.js或React,后端则多采用Spring Boot、Django或Node.js等技术栈。数据库方面,MySQL、PostgreSQL或MongoDB等均是常见选择。
以一个典型的职业院校“一站式网上办事大厅”为例,其核心功能包括:学生信息管理、课程安排、成绩查询、学籍变更、请假审批、就业服务等。为了确保系统的稳定性与安全性,通常还会引入微服务架构,采用Spring Cloud或Kubernetes进行容器化部署。
三、系统架构设计
1. 前端架构
前端采用响应式设计,适配不同设备访问。主要使用Vue.js框架,结合Element UI组件库构建界面。通过Axios与后端进行通信,实现数据的动态加载与交互。
2. 后端架构
后端采用Spring Boot框架,提供RESTful API接口。通过Spring Security实现权限控制,确保系统安全。同时,利用MyBatis进行数据库操作,提高代码可维护性。
3. 数据库设计
数据库采用MySQL,设计多张表,包括用户表、角色表、权限表、业务表等。通过外键关联,确保数据的一致性与完整性。
四、核心功能模块实现
1. 用户登录与权限管理
用户登录功能是整个系统的基础,采用JWT(JSON Web Token)进行身份验证。用户输入用户名和密码后,系统验证通过后生成Token并返回给前端,后续请求携带Token即可完成身份识别。
2. 业务办理模块
业务办理模块涵盖学生请假、学籍变更、奖学金申请等常见事务。每个业务流程均通过工作流引擎(如Activiti)进行配置,实现灵活的流程管理。
3. 数据统计与可视化
系统提供数据统计功能,包括学生人数、课程开设情况、业务办理数量等。通过ECharts或D3.js实现图表展示,帮助管理人员直观掌握系统运行状况。
五、源码实现示例
以下为“一站式网上办事大厅”系统中部分关键功能的源码示例:
1. 用户登录接口(Spring Boot后端)
@RestController
@RequestMapping("/api/auth")
public class AuthController {
@Autowired
private UserService userService;
@PostMapping("/login")
public ResponseEntity<String> login(@RequestBody LoginRequest request) {
String token = userService.login(request.getUsername(), request.getPassword());
if (token != null) {
return ResponseEntity.ok(token);
} else {
return ResponseEntity.status(HttpStatus.UNAUTHORIZED).body("Invalid username or password");
}
}
}
2. 登录请求对象(Java实体类)
public class LoginRequest {
private String username;
private String password;
// getters and setters
}
3. Vue.js前端登录页面(HTML + JavaScript)

六、系统安全性与性能优化
1. 安全性设计

系统在开发过程中注重安全性,采用HTTPS协议进行数据传输,防止中间人攻击。同时,对用户输入进行严格校验,防止SQL注入和XSS攻击。
2. 性能优化
为提升系统响应速度,采用缓存机制(如Redis)存储常用数据。此外,使用Nginx进行负载均衡,提升并发处理能力。
七、职业院校的应用场景与效果
“一站式网上办事大厅”在职业院校中的应用,显著提高了行政办公效率,减少了纸质材料的使用,降低了人工成本。同时,学生和教师可以通过平台快速获取所需信息,提升了整体满意度。
例如,在某职业技术学院实施该系统后,学生请假审批时间由原来的3天缩短至1小时内,学籍变更流程也由线下转为线上,极大提高了工作效率。
八、未来发展方向
随着人工智能、大数据等技术的发展,“一站式网上办事大厅”未来可以进一步融合智能客服、数据分析、个性化推荐等功能,为职业院校提供更加智能化的服务。此外,系统还可以与外部平台(如教育部统一认证系统)对接,实现数据共享与互联互通。
九、结语
综上所述,“一站式网上办事大厅”作为职业院校信息化建设的重要组成部分,具有广泛的应用前景和发展潜力。通过合理的系统设计与技术实现,能够有效提升学校管理效率与服务质量。未来,随着技术的不断进步,该系统将在职业教育领域发挥更加重要的作用。